'Finally! I was starving!', I exclaim as I lay my tray on the round table. 'So was I.', Gray says smiling at my exaggeration. The thing that I loved the most about Gray was that he understood me. He listens to my thoughts. Gray interrupts my thoughts, 'Are you feeling okay?', he asks. I smile and help myself for a kiss. 'I'll take that as a yes.', he says taken by surprise. I look around to see some people staring... some seeing us in disgust, others looking at us like a good couple, and others just glad that Gray is attending this school.

'Geez.', Gray blurts out giving me a heavy stare. 'What?', I blurt out, worried that I might have done something wrong. 'Oh nothing... it's just that you seem cuter by the minute.', he says. He lays his arm across my shoulder and lays his chin on my head for a while. I lay my head on his chest, and hear the thuds of his heart. It oddly comforted me. I could have slept all day on his chest if he told me to. He breaks off the snuggling and we continue eating. 'Eating hard or hardly eating', I hear a familiar voice. I look up to see Randy...

'Oh.... hi guys.', I greet them, surprised by their presence. Randy and Dakota usually sit in a table that only involves both of them so they can fill eachother with kisses and "love".

'Can we join you guys? Our usual table is occupied by some other kids...', Dakota explains. 'Sure.', I hand gesture them to sit. It's awkwardly silent for a few minutes as we eat. 'So... you like apple juice.', Randy asks Gray obviously trying to start a conversation. 'Yeah... it has a better taste than orange juice to me.', Gray replies. The conversation fades quickly and we go silent again. Gray chugs the last of his juice and stands up. 'Gotta go to the restroom. Be right back babe.', he says giving me a peck on the lips. It takes me a minute to realize Dakotas and Randys reaction. Which tell me they didn't know about me and Gray...

'Was I dreaming? Or did Gray really just call you babe and kiss you?', Randy said raising an eyebrow. Dakota was all smiles. 'Awww you guys look so cute together.', she said. I blush and thank her. Different from Randy who seemed mad or extremely curious about us. 'I thought you were friends.', he said gazing at me deeply. 'Well yesterday after you guys left, Gray asked me to be his boyfriend.', I explained to Randy. He tried to pull off a normal reaction like a simple "oh"... but failed when I saw how agressive he started picking at his boneless chicken. 'Urgh! What the hell do they put on this chicken!', he shouts frusturated. The table shakes when Randy gives up and stabs the chicken with his fork. Dakota and I look at him in silence. Gray interrupts our awkward stares when he comes back from the restroom. 'Want to walk around outside?', Gray requests. 'Sure... I could use some fresh air.', I mumble. 'After you my eye candy.', he says. I can't help but laugh. 'Are we still meeting up on saturday?', Randy asks before I leave. 'I'm not sure, depends on whether I'm... busy... or not.', I say, giving somewhat of a flirtish wink at Gray. He grins and leans in to kiss me. 'WELL...', Randy says in a loud tone, braking our kiss. 'I hope you don't postpone the date. You know how grumpy I get about that.', he says, almost as if he was demanding not to cancel him. 'Don't worry... I'll tell you if there's a change of plans.', I say annoyed by his tone of voice. Randy lets out a grumpy grunt and mumbles words. 'Shall we go?', I ask Gray. We walk... leaving Randy and Dakota alone in our table.

'Ugh, this weather is so darn hot!', Gray says waving his hands towards his face, making a hand fan. 'Almost as hot as you.', I tell Gray. He smiles. 'You know, if you keep complimenting me, I might just die of smiling one of these days.', he jokes. We sit on a bench and compliment eachother for quite some time. 'That Randy guy sure is a jealous best friend, isn't he?', he brings up randomly. 'I think he's just trying to make an effort of not losing me as his best friend.', I say thinking about Randys reactions. 'Oh, just like when he made an effort of not forgetting you when he first went out with Dakota?', he said sarcastically. I was speechless, that was actually true. I remember telling Gray about my past events with Randy and some of Angelo. I didn't think he would backfire using them. Good thing I haven't told him about both of them knowing that I had a crush on them.

'Sorry... but the way I see it, he is being unfair.', Gray said. 'Yeah... I guess he kind of is.', I say, giving up on trying to find an excuse for him. Something deep down in me told me that Randy was jealous... not of my friend/relationship with Gray... but jealous of how happy I am with Gray. I shake my head, hoping to get those thoughts out of my mind by doing so. 'We better go back to classes, we don't want to be late.', Gray says.

After school, I convince Gray to walk with me to the bakery so he could meet my grandmother. Besides my craving for donuts at the moment. We enter the bakery, the sudden smell of fresh baked bread and strawberry jam filled cookies fill my nose. My stomach groans. 'Hey Grandma', I say, as I see her finish up with a customer. 'Hello Artie!, how was school?', she asks. 'Good, as usual.', I tell her. 'Well... did you just drop by to say hello?', my grandmother asked as she packed me a bag of donuts and cookies. 'Actually... to say hello and so you could meet.... my boyfriend.', I told her shyly. She stopped what she was doing and turned around. She looks at gray for the first time and chuckles. 'Oh Artie... you should have told me earlier... I look all dirty.', she said wiping her hands on her apron and fixing her hair. 'Seth Stein', my grandmother held her hand out. 'Gray Andrews, at your services.', Gray says kissing her hand. 'Ooo what a gentleman', grandma tells him. Gray smiles with success. 'Well grandma, I'll see you later... don't want to distract you from work.', I tell her. 'Alright Artie, you kids be good now. Nothing funky okay?', she says. My face immediately turns red. We make our way back to my house. 'Charming... isn't she?', Gray said wanting to laugh. 'Sure... you can call her that.', I said recovering from the embarrassing moments my grandmother put me through.

We get to the house and as usual, Angelo is working. 'Hey Angelo.', I call out. 'Hey Carter.',he says waving. As we get closer he greets Gray. 'Oh... Hey Gray.', Angelo shakes his hand. Gray responds with a nod and smile. 'Still working I see...', I tell Angelo. 'Yeah, since we got out of school.', he says. 'That's about an hour and a half ago.',I told him. He nods. 'Well, you can go anytime you want.', I say. 'Yeah... i'll just finish this up.', he says. 'Hey sugar pop?', Gray asks crossing his arms infront of my chest and giving me a tight hug. 'Yeah?', I answer. 'I gotta go already.', he says rubbing our cheeks together. 'Already? Can't you move in with me?', I joked. Gray laughs. 'I wish... you could replace my teddy bear if we were to move in together.', he says. 'You have a teddy bear?', I said smirking. 'No, but it would be a pleasure if you were my teddy bear.', Gray winks and leans in for a kiss. 'See you tomorrow...', he tells me. 'Later Angelo', he shouts before leaving. Angelo... I totally forgot he was here...

I look over to him and see him very concentrated on his work. 'Well... ima be inside, you can leave whenever you w-'.... 'how long have you guys been going out?', he cut me off. 'Just yesterday.', I tell him. 'Oh.', he simply mutters. Unlike Randys "oh", Angelos "oh" actually gave me the feeling that he didn't care. 'Why?', I asked him. 'Just curious... not every guy hugs and kisses another one, so I figured.', he said, still focusing on his work like always. 'So how are things with Hannah?', I asked. 'Good... she's now officially my girlfriend.', he says. 'Since when?', I ask. 'About three or four days ago.', he says. 'Glad to hear the news.', I tell him. 'Of course you are.', he says with a sarcastic tone. 'Why wouldn't I? I mean if I have a boyfriend, then you should get a girlfriend.', I say. 'Uh huh.', he says grinning. 'Angelo... I don't have a crush over you anymore. So please stop with your sarcastic tones.', I tell him. 'Gray is more than enough hot stuff for me.', I say adding more fuel to the fire. 'Whatever.', he said annoyed.

'BABE!', a sudden yelling makes us turn around. Hannah. 'Ohh... speak of the devil', I blurt out. 'Are you ready to go?', she asks Angelo. 'Yeah... i'm done for today.', he says walking towards her. They kiss, and at one point Angelo looks at me as if saying, 'my kisses are for her not for you'. A true eye locking moment between us. As for hannah, she was prettier than the last time I saw her. 'Well... see you tomorrow Carter.', Angelo waved. I waved back. 'Good luck with gray...', he laughed while walking and hugging Hannah.

Hmmm so he thinks Gray and I can't reach their level? Well... two can play at that game.
